Financial Experience

topic
Financial experience — the direct management of money in its full complexity, including the experience of financial constraint, financial risk, and financial decision-making under uncertainty — provides the grounded understanding of economic reality that abstract economic knowledge cannot replicate, and that is structurally absent from the experience of people who have always been insulated from financial precarity.

Role

Financial experience is the creative input that most directly grounds abstract economic thinking in lived material reality — with the person who has experienced genuine financial constraint having a specific understanding of how economic scarcity actually shapes decision-making, opportunity access, and psychological experience that no amount of economic theory can fully replicate. The creator who has navigated financial difficulty has direct creative input into the experiences of the majority of the world's population in ways that the creator who has always been economically insulated does not.
